Transaction 38ec79d3237141e900a71cfe11a7d946e7dbf163214e6dd0f0a984410689c94f

1 Input
2 Outputs
  • 38ec79d3237141e900a71cfe11a7d946e7dbf163214e6dd0f0a984410689c94f:0
  • value  1230093
    address  3FJp9RTWCgSjQ2MRBwziFD2oTi3BPaHM2t
  • 38ec79d3237141e900a71cfe11a7d946e7dbf163214e6dd0f0a984410689c94f:1
  • value  1494490676
    address  bc1qauxpp4qjgc8vqv4lfehxyt8aq4rz2hkkfzgvfc